Service Mark Examples A familiar example of service marks comes from United Airlines. The name "United Airlines," the "Fly the Friendly Skies" tagline, and the logo of a world map are service marks. This is because United provides a service: airline flights around the world.
It's how customers recognize you in the marketplace and distinguish you from your competitors. The word ?trademark? can refer to both trademarks and service marks. A trademark is used for goods, while a service mark is used for services.
To register a trademark with the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O), you will need to fill out and submit a trademark application. You can do this online, using the Trademark Electronic Application System (TEAS), an online trademark filing service, or you can submit a paper application.
For example, a tag or label for the goods, a container/packaging for the goods, a display associated with the goods, or a photograph of the goods are examples of trademark specimens. A service mark specimen is an actual example of how you are using the mark in commerce on or in connection with the identified services.
Quick answer: A trademark is a word, phrase, symbol or logo that is used to brand, identify, and distinguish a product. A service mark (or servicemark) is a word, phrase, symbol or logo that is used to brand, identify, and distinguish a service.
A trade name is the name a business chooses to do business under. It is commonly known as the ?doing business as? (DBA) name and can differ from the company's business name. If you produce goods, you would be applying for a trademark. If you ?produce? or provide a service, you would be applying for a service mark.
